Abstract

A new method for identifying a deterministic jitter (DJ) model in a total jitter (TJ) distribution is introduced in this paper. The new method is based on the characteristic function and identifies the DJ model from the given TJ PDF contaminated by an unknown DJ PDF. Benchmark testing using sinusoidal jitter provides validation of the new method for high-performance identification of the DJ model. Experiments on a variety of TJ PDFs also validate the very low false alarm probability of the new method.
